NASA - Parker Solar Probe |
|
The Parker solar probe spacecraft has been launched successfully by Nasa. It was sent off into space on board the Delta-IV Heavy Rocket from Cape Canaveral in Florida. The satellite is designed to fly within six million kilometres of the Sun – closer than ever before.

How the Sentinel Telescope Works |
|
Sentinel is a space-based infrared (IR) survey mission to discover and catalog 90 percent of the asteroids larger than 140 meters in Earth’s region of the solar system.
